Introduction to standards:

This standard applies to oxygen hose and gas hose joints for gas welding and gas cutting. This standard refers to the international standard ISO 3253-1975 (E) "Hose joints for welding, cutting and related process equipment". 2 Technical requirements
11 -8: 8
13-8:458
2.1 The connecting thread shall comply with the relevant provisions of GB192-81 "Basic tooth profile of common thread", GB196-81 "Basic dimensions of common thread" and GB197-81 "Tolerance and fit of common thread". Right-handed thread is used for oxygen and non-flammable gas, and left-handed thread is used for flammable gas.
2.2 All parts shall be made of corrosion-resistant materials, but threaded joints and hose joints for gas shall not be made of alloys with a copper content of more than 70%.
